Annual Payout Ratio:
39.13%+5.07%(+14.89%)Summary
- As of today (July 26, 2025), FFBC annual payout ratio is 39.13%, with the most recent change of +5.07% (+14.89%) on December 31, 2024.
- During the last 3 years, FFBC annual payout ratio has fallen by -3.43% (-8.06%).
- FFBC annual payout ratio is now -69.20% below its all-time high of 127.05%, reached on December 31, 2013.

TTM Payout Ratio:
38.40%0.00%(0.00%)Summary
- As of today (July 26, 2025), FFBC TTM payout ratio is 38.40%, unchanged on July 25, 2025.
- Over the past year, FFBC TTM payout ratio has increased by +0.54% (+1.43%).
- FFBC TTM payout ratio is now -75.11% below its all-time high of 154.29%.
